Originally Posted by Rossi
I am hoping to get some insights to the iCode mid-pipe. Why did you not add the iCode axle-back instead of HKS? Did you keep the cats on the mid-pipe, are those high flow? Where did you get one? And if you don’t mind sharing the cost.
Oh sorry. I wanted something a little louder than the icode, I had their full header back system on my 2013 and it was pretty quiet. And I honestly didn't expect them to still make the system for the IS-F. I ordered the HKS thinking I'd just modify the stock midpipe or make a new one. I then contacted my source in Japan and he said Icode can still make the exhaust (6-7 week wait). Yes, I do want and kept the high flow cats since the novel headers will not have any.

Originally Posted by Joe Z
So what did they say to correct this ??

Joe Z
DSS is supposedly sending me one. I asked sikky about the balance, they said the pucks are balanced on their own...I am skeptical since the one on the diff end is marked in relation to the shaft and their video instruction said the adapters are balanced with the shaft.
